Lines Matching defs:frames_per_block
3371 input_fpb = track->mixer->frames_per_block;
3992 KASSERTMSG(src->head % track->mixer->frames_per_block == 0,
3993 "src->head=%d track->mixer->frames_per_block=%d",
3994 src->head, track->mixer->frames_per_block);
4122 KASSERTMSG(src->head % track->mixer->frames_per_block == 0,
4123 "src->head=%d track->mixer->frames_per_block=%d",
4124 src->head, track->mixer->frames_per_block);
4939 count = uimin(dstcount, track->mixer->frames_per_block);
5211 u_int frames_per_block;
5223 frames_per_block = fmt->sample_rate * blktime / 1000;
5224 if ((frames_per_block & 1) != 0)
5280 mixer->frames_per_block = frame_per_block(mixer, &mixer->hwbuf.fmt);
5281 blksize = frametobyte(&mixer->hwbuf.fmt, mixer->frames_per_block);
5305 mixer->frames_per_block = blksize * NBBY /
5310 mixer->blktime_n = mixer->frames_per_block;
5313 capacity = mixer->frames_per_block * hwblks;
5342 capacity = mixer->frames_per_block * hwblks;
5398 len = mixer->frames_per_block * mixer->mixfmt.channels *
5407 len = mixer->frames_per_block * mixer->mixfmt.channels *
5423 mixer->codecbuf.capacity = mixer->frames_per_block;
5522 while (mixer->hwbuf.used < mixer->frames_per_block * minimum) {
5588 frame_count = mixer->frames_per_block;
5624 if (track->outbuf.used < mixer->frames_per_block &&
5792 count = uimin(count, mixer->frames_per_block);
5825 for (; i < mixer->frames_per_block * mixer->mixfmt.channels; i++)
5850 remain = mixer->frames_per_block - count;
5883 KASSERTMSG(mixer->hwbuf.used >= mixer->frames_per_block,
5884 "mixer->hwbuf.used=%d mixer->frames_per_block=%d",
5885 mixer->hwbuf.used, mixer->frames_per_block);
5887 blksize = frametobyte(&mixer->hwbuf.fmt, mixer->frames_per_block);
5946 mixer->hw_complete_counter += mixer->frames_per_block;
5949 auring_take(&mixer->hwbuf, mixer->frames_per_block);
5973 if (mixer->hwbuf.used >= mixer->frames_per_block) {
5979 if (mixer->hwbuf.used < mixer->frames_per_block) {
6070 count = uimin(count, mixer->frames_per_block);
6089 tmpsrc.capacity = mixer->frames_per_block;
6159 if (input->capacity - input->used < mixer->frames_per_block) {
6160 int drops = mixer->frames_per_block -
6169 KASSERTMSG(auring_tail(input) % mixer->frames_per_block == 0,
6170 "inputtail=%d mixer->frames_per_block=%d",
6171 auring_tail(input), mixer->frames_per_block);
6200 blksize = frametobyte(&mixer->hwbuf.fmt, mixer->frames_per_block);
6259 mixer->hw_complete_counter += mixer->frames_per_block;
6262 auring_push(&mixer->hwbuf, mixer->frames_per_block);